Betta fish and fin rot prevention

My betta's fins look a bit ragged lately. I do weekly water changes, 20%, in a 5-gallon tank with a sponge filter. Temp stays at 78F. What else can I do to prevent fin rot?

Yo, fin rot's a pain but fixable. First, check your water params, ammonia and nitrite gotta be zero. If they're not, that's your culprit. Also, maybe bump those water changes to 30%, twice a week till it clears. I'd add some Indian almond leaves, they're clutch for healing.

Agreed on the almond leaves. They've worked wonders for my fish. Also, make sure there's nothing sharp in the tank tearing their fins.

I've had success with aquarium salt, just a teaspoon per gallon. It's gentle but effective. Also, what's your feeding routine? Overfeeding can mess with water quality big time.

I'd skip the salt if you've got live plants. It can stress them out. Focus on clean water and maybe a betta-specific antibiotic if it's bad.
